ASK NASA!

React app using an open source NASA API. It always shows the latest " Astronomy Picture of the Day" but you can browse any photos from previous days as well by choosing a specific date. I also created a gallery that shows the pictures in chronological order.

I created this app for practice during my studies.

I have removed my API KEY from the codebase so it is not going to show any pictures!
